Abstract
An invader leech species Archaeobdella esmonti (Clitellata: Hirudinida) was found during hydrobiological research in 2016 in the Volga and Volga-Kama reaches of the Kuybyshev Reservoir. This indicates the continuing process of spreading of this alien leech species in the Kuybyshev Reservoir and the colonization of new habitats on a considerable area of the upstream part of the reservoir. The article describes the occurrence and quantitative abundance of A. esmonti in the studied water area.
